Artificial intelligence (AI) agents are rapidly becoming a core driver of business automation. Harnessing the power of generative AI and large language models (LLMs) through agentic frameworks introduces powerful new ways to streamline operations, boost productivity, and free users from tedious and time-wasting tasks. By designing and deploying agents responsibly and effectively, organizations can accelerate adoption, reduce risks, and gain a competitive advantage in the impending "agentic shift."
This course is an introduction to AI agents from a strategic business perspective. It will not teach you how to build agents—instead, it will teach you how to determine whether, where, and how agents should exist in your organization.
This course is designed for business leaders, consultants, product and project managers, and other decision makers who are interested in unlocking the power of agentic AI to enhance business processes. It's also a great starting point for technical practitioners who have been tasked with implementing agentic solutions in the organization.
This course is also designed to assist students in preparing for the CertNexus® AgenticAIBIZ™ (Exam AGZ-110) credential.
In this course, you will: identify the fundamentals of agentic AI; determine whether AI agents are suitable for a given business problem; design business-driven agentic solutions at a high level, without going deep into the technical details; manage the risks of agentic AI; adopt agentic AI into the organization; and prepare to execute an agentic strategy so implementation can proceed.

There's always a certain degree of hype around emerging technologies, and agentic artificial intelligence (AI) is no different. It's important to temper your expectations by understanding that agentic AI is not always the best choice for every organization in every situation. In some cases, traditional tools or human-driven effort are still the most effective approaches. In this lesson, you'll determine whether agentic AI is a good fit for the organization's needs.
